- The distance between Kirensk, Russia and Tabriz, Iran is approximately 4,884 km or 3,035 mi.
- To reach Kirensk in this distance one would set out from Tabriz bearing 42.6°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Kirensk bearing 91.2° or E .
- Kirensk has a boreal subarctic climate with no dry season (Dfc) whereas Tabriz has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k).
- Kirensk is in or near the boreal moist forest biome whereas Tabriz is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ome.
- The average temperature is 16.2 °C (29.2°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 15.6 °C (28.1°F) more in Kirensk. The continentality subtype is truly continental for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 75.4 mm (3 in) more which is equivalent to 75.4 l/m² (1.85 US gal/ft²) or 754,000 l/ha (80,608 US gal/ac) more. About 1 1/4 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 19.6° lower in Kirensk than in Tabriz.
- Relative humidity levels are 20.3%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 10.4°C (18.7°F) lower.
